You may have heard this before, but this time it's no false alarm: Brian Wilson is back. After years of public psychodramas and not-quite comebacks, the Beach Boys' mastermind turned up last night in better shape and stronger voice that longtime fans would dare hope for.
It didn't hurt that the second half of the show was devoted to the Beach Boys' 1966 epic "Pet Sounds" - one of the few "greatest albums ever made" that lives up to its reputation. But even before that, Wilson showed a sense of purpose that was largely missing in his Symphony Hall performance last year.
